This happens to me quite often: I upload a group of files via FTP by drag
and dropping them on the server window. The transfer is successful, but
Cyberduck ends the transaction by reporting that the transfer is
incomplete. This doesn't happen if I just upload one file and wait for it
to transfer and then transfer another. Also, when I do this, the files
occupy only one lane in the transfer window; I've set the upload limit to
one file at a time, and I'd expect each file to have its own lane, but
they don't. Maybe the problem is related to this.
I then have to download the files to make sure they're ok, and the
archives always extract without issues. I don't know why Cyberduck is
reporting the transfer as a failure, but it's very annoying because I have
have to keep downloading the files to verify them.
